Output 42db45d77c76b26b3ba844476e223acf60bf59b1d2ee65f3c1fc0b0d9467205d:4

value
41580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da4ede1432e3a41f123db9d782f4fafb6149da0 OP_EQUAL
address
3Bgm9wFrm21b6bj2JLvZibeDwjs4diC2J2
transaction
42db45d77c76b26b3ba844476e223acf60bf59b1d2ee65f3c1fc0b0d9467205d
spent
true